Free online greeting card maker or poetry art generator. Create free custom printable greeting cards or art from photos and text online. Use PoetrySoup's free online software to make greeting cards from poems, quotes, or your own words. Generate memes, cards, or poetry art for any occasion; weddings, anniversaries, holidays, etc (See examples here). Make a card to show your loved one how special they are to you. Once you make a card, you can email it, download it, or share it with others on your favorite social network site like Facebook. Also, you can create shareable and downloadable cards from poetry on PoetrySoup. Use our poetry search engine to find the perfect poem, and then click the camera icon to create the card or art.

Helplessly Hoping
Helplessly hoping I close my eyes in search of a good night. Tossing and turning they open to greet the morning light. I rise out of bed running, hoping I can fly. Only to stumble and fall when I hear goodbye. Helplessly hoping I walk through the door to view a purple sky. Wondering I keep to myself, thinking what I need to get by. Seeing not so easy when you consider the meaning inside. Just for a moment I linger, was I just there for the ride? Helplessly hoping my spirit feels lost as the day goes by. I seem to collide with the material world no matter what I try. Seeking salvation I cry and drop down to my knees. Feeling like I am forsaken I still ask God please. Helplessly hoping the answers before me disappear from sight. Suddenly I stand by myself in darkness who turned out the light? Memories linger and my heart remembers yet retreat like the tide. The moments before me are passing and then I turn to hide. Helplessly hoping I just help myself but I’m so alone. Searching again inside, I wonder where I shall call home. My feet start to shake, I feel like I’m standing on a fault line. Everything around me slips away leaving me with just time. Helplessly hoping my mind starts to crumble like the ground under my feet. I run just as fast as I can but there was only me to beat. I listen as the wind it whispers, everything’s alright. The circle of life is unbroken as I return back to the night.
